You don't want your ancestors life

Nostalgia is denial - denial of the painful present... the name for this denial is golden age thinking - the erroneous notion that a different time period is better than the one ones living in - its a flaw in the romantic imagination of those people who find it difficult to cope with the present.

from Midnight in Paris by Woody Allen


Here are all the ways in which your life is better than your ancestors : 

1. You live longer by virtue of sewage treatment, modern medical care and clean drinking water. 
2. You have the option of picking whatever activity you enjoy. There is no imposed lifestyle. Gyms, travel, sport. You name it and the option probably exists. 
3. There are no cultural or regional shackles to the food you can eat. 
4. You have access to test, vet or pay a premium for food that adheres to your moral or ethical preferences. 
5. There is no shortage of calories or nutrients available to you. Cheaper than it has ever been. This is significant. 
6. Electricity, pursuit of work we find fuilfiling and law & order makes our existence less stressful for the most part. 


What we lost 

1. Activity as a necessity for our existence. I get a feeling our ancestors would trade with us on this one.
2. Poor air quality.
3. General ennui over a lack of purpose or meaning for how we spend our time. When you are not slogging for personal survival or are even mildly skeptical about the consumer capitalist rat race, it can be stressful. This is heightened when you generally feel like society is replete with double standards, inconsistent imposition of rules and just profiteering above all else. But this pales in comparison to spiteful rulers, famines, disease, lack of opportuntities and just the uncertainty that has characterised most of human history. 

Takeaway 

It’s mostly a good time to be alive. Better than most times in human history. Can we make the most of it? Or will we drown in excess and without purpose.
